Excavation services involve the careful removal or movement of earth, soil, and other materials from a property to prepare for construction, landscaping, or other projects. This work typically uses heavy machinery such as excavators, bulldozers, and backhoes to dig trenches, level land, or create foundations. Homeowners may need excavation when building a new garage, installing a pool, or making significant landscape changes. Proper excavation ensures that the ground is properly prepared, stable, and ready for the next phase of construction or landscaping.

These services help address a variety of common problems homeowners face. For example, uneven terrain or poorly graded land can lead to drainage issues or foundation problems over time. Excavation can correct these issues by reshaping the land to improve water flow and stability. It also helps remove old or unwanted structures, roots, or debris that might interfere with new construction. By properly excavating a site, property owners can prevent future issues related to water pooling, soil erosion, or structural instability.

The overview below groups typical Excavation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kenmore,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Projects - Typical costs for minor excavation jobs, such as digging for a new fence post or small landscaping features,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.

Medium-Sized Excavation - Larger landscaping or foundation prep projects usually c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for residential properties and tend to stay within this moderate cost band.

Full Property Excavation - Complete yard or lot excavation, including grading and site clearing, can range from $4,000 to $10,000 depending on size and complexity. Larger, more intricate projects may exceed this range but are less frequent.

Specialized or Complex Jobs - Unusual or highly complex excavation work, such as dealing with difficult soil conditions or extensive site prep, can cost $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and typically involve detailed planning and equipment.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
